Polish officials will begin checks at German border from today

Jul 07, 2025

Warsaw [Poland], July 7: Polish officials will begin checks on the border with Germany on Monday, focusing on vehicles with tinted windows and those carrying multiple passengers, border guard spokesman Konrad Szwed told the PAP news agency.
The spot checks will concentrate on buses, minibuses and cars with multiple passengers, he said. "Vehicles with tinted windows will also be in focus," Szwed said.
Poland is introducing checks on the German border from midnight on Sunday in response to German moves to block irregular migration directly at the border.
The Polish authorities will also be conducting checks along the Lithuanian border.
Germany has been conducting spot checks on the Polish border since October 2023, but German Interior Minister Alexander Dobrindt announced shortly after taking office in May that these checks would be stepped up and that asylum seekers could be turned back at the border.
